Abstract
In an A/D converter for electrical signals, the difference, between the instantaneous analog input signal Y(t) and a previous analog signal value Y(t-T), is converted in a fast analog-to-digital converter (3) to a digital sum value. This sum value is added to the preceding digital value, stored in a buffer memory (7, 7'), and the result is fed to a slow but precise D/A converter (2) for generation of the next Y(t-T) value. This has the advantage that good results can be obtained with A/D converters less expensive than those heretofore required to obtain such results.
